I spoke with MS today, since I was going to attempt to trade some points for some time in Hawaii. She informed me that a new memo had just come out saying that effective July 1, if you call and ask to have the $75 search to trade done for you, they will assign you whatever comes up. I confirmed with her that this means no more phone call and 48 hour turn around to say yeah or neah and she said that is correct. This was new from yesterday when I first inquired about it. This is consistent with the way II normally does things. Unfortunately for DVC members this was one of the major positives to DVC exchanging and one of the reasons that I've tended to remind people thinking of buying in that this system could easily change for the negative. Apparently making the $75 exchange fee "non refundable" was meant to curb casual searches and did not appear to work well for this purpose. It simply means you should not search for things/times you are not prepared to accept. For II in general you can cancel any exchange within 24 ours of the match like it never happened. We'll see if this is incorporated into the DVC version, I would bet so if this change actually is forthcoming.
